A time-traveling duo confronts cosmic chaos, challenging divine myths while uncovering their own flawed humanity in a hilarious quest.
Episodes
Skuld gets a visit from a real time lord named Doctor What, who suspiciously looks like Adam Conover, and is secretly pretending to be a lame second rate impersonator on Public Access as his cover. She is not impressed.
Earth's Population and the Goddesses are re-situated on the futuristic world of Planet Belldandy, where Skuld decides to sell off her invention patents to finance her ironically insane vision for a family restaurant named Casa De La Skuld.
Yggdrasil Central finds itself under attack by a cyber terrorist calling himself The Gremlin. Doctor What and Lind have one hour to find their way to the center of a deadly teleporter maze before he drops Yggdrasil out of the Sky.
In order to prove himself as a new full time Ah My Goddess cast member, the Goddesses demand Doctor What travel back in time to assassinate the creators of Evangelion so they can have a real produced Season Three.
Kevin from the Other Dimension goes for 48 Hours without Sleep and writes two of the craziest stories you've ever read. The first one is about overcoming writer's block, and the second one muses on the metaphorical nature of God.
Adam Ruins Bad Goddess showcases what Kevin Neece's Ah My Goddess Fan Film spinoff would look like if Adam Conover and Rhea Butcher from Adam Ruins Everything both played the public access time lord character Doctor What.
